Under which constitutional reform was Diarchy introduced at the provincial level?
AMorley-Minto Reforms (1909)
BMontagu-Chelmsford Reforms (1919) ✓ Correct
CSimon Commission Report (1927)
DGovernment of India Act (1935)
Correct answer: (B) Montagu-Chelmsford Reforms (1919) — Diarchy was introduced under the Montagu-Chelmsford Reforms, so the answer is the Montagu-Chelmsford Reforms of 1919.
Explanation
★Diarchy was introduced under the Montagu-Chelmsford Reforms, so the answer is the Montagu-Chelmsford Reforms of 1919.
★These reforms followed Montagu's statement of August 1917.
★The government announced them in July 1918.
★On their basis the Government of India Act of 1919 was enacted.
★The Act introduced diarchy in the executive at the provincial level.
★Diarchy meant the rule of two, executive councillors and popular ministers.
